Rafael Cambra Uno 2022 is a red wine made from old monastrell vineyards, nearly 60 years old, cultivated organically on calcareous and sandy-loam soils. A Mediterranean red that offers a marked varietal typicity and presents itself as balanced and harmonious, very expressive and with fine tannins.

Rafael Cambra Uno is an intense cherry red wine.
On the nose, it features aromas of red and black fruit, milky touches, and sweet spicy notes.
On the palate, its unctuousness stands out. It is fresh, balanced, and with well-integrated wood.

Rafael Cambra is a winery that was established in 2001, in an old garage in Ontinyet. Later on, in 2008, it moved to the Valencian town of Fontanars dels Alforins, where the winery has 42 hectares of vineyards (12 owned and 30 leased).
The small producer who gives his name to the winery, Rafael Cambra, strongly advocates for minimal intervention both in the vineyard and during the winemaking processes, aiming to create pure and honest wines, with the grape as the main protagonist.
Their vineyards of monastrell, over half a century old, are cultivated on clay-limestone soils at more than 700 meters above sea level, in the heart of the Sierra de L´Ombria. They also work with foreign varieties such as cabernet sauvignon and cabernet franc grapes.
In recent years, Rafael Cambra has been deeply committed to the recovery of indigenous varieties such as forcallat, arco, bonicaire, and rojal. With these, they are starting to produce new wines that are sure to draw attention.
The wines from this winery reflect the maturity brought by the sun of this land. They are warm wines, with an intense color, aromas of red fruits, yet fresh, thanks to the location and altitude.
